Course Overview

Pursue your ambitions in business and management with the BSc (Hons) Accountancy at Coventry University. Based in Coventry, England, this programme combines theoretical knowledge with practical application, with a 3-year full-time structure. Develop your knowledge and skills to help businesses and organisations manage finances, make management decisions, face economic challenges and grow ethically and sustainably. Accountants with the skills to monitor the flow of money for a business while being able to spot and protect against potential challenges, are highly sought after. Global uncertainty and the challenges of the economic climate, mean that skills in this field could be more important than ever before.
